什么是NAT限制?
移动宽带运营商为节省IPv4地址资源,通常采用严格型NAT(NAT444),导致用户设备无法直接暴露公网IP。这会限制P2P连接、在线游戏、远程访问等场景的兼容性。
检测NAT类型的方法
通过以下步骤可快速检测当前网络NAT类型:
- 使用在线工具(如Speedtest或专门的NAT检测网站)
- 运行命令行工具
netstat -ano
观察端口映射状态 - 检查路由器管理界面中的WAN IP与本地IP的关联性
解决方案1:使用VPN或代理
通过全隧道VPN服务可绕过运营商NAT限制:
- 选择支持UDP协议的VPN供应商
- 启用VPN的穿透NAT功能
- 配置应用程序通过VPN接口通信
解决方案2:配置端口转发
在支持端口转发的路由器中设置规则:
- 登录路由器管理界面
- 创建TCP/UDP端口映射规则
- 绑定目标设备的局域网IP
解决方案3:UPnP与NAT-PMP协议
启用路由器自动端口管理协议:
协议 | 兼容设备 |
---|---|
UPnP | Windows/Xbox/PS |
NAT-PMP | MacOS/iOS设备 |
进阶方案:STUN/TURN服务器
针对企业级应用,可采用NAT穿透协议栈:
- STUN服务器用于发现公网地址
- TURN服务器作为中继备份方案
- WebRTC框架的标准化实现方案
通过组合使用VPN、端口映射和标准化协议,可有效突破移动宽带NAT限制。建议普通用户优先尝试UPnP或商业VPN方案,开发者则可集成STUN/TURN协议实现系统级穿透。
内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/461012.html